The crossing of the Drake Passage takes around 36 hours.
Talks on the wildlife of Antarctica, the history of exploration and the
guidelines of the region that must be observed, will be given during
these days at sea before the excursions commence. Explore the South
Shetland Islands, and isles along the Antarctic Peninsula. Visit penguin
colonies, discover ice formations and look out for whales, dolphins,
seals and sea birds. The itinerary depends on ice, sea and weather
conditions, but usually includes Deception Island, Port Lockroy, Cuverville
Island, Vernadsky Base, Arctowski Base, Paradise Bay, Half Moon Island
and the iceberg-lined Lemaire Channel. On these days, regular land
and boat excursions will take place.
